Hadronic electromagnetic form factors and color transparency

Abstract
We review the current status of electromagnetic form factor calculations in perturbative QCD. There is growing evidence that factorization prescriptions involving a transverse coordinate integration, such as that of Li and Sterman, are more appropriate than the prescription of LePage and Brodsky. Color transparency is naturally described within the formalism. We report the first explicit calculations of color transparency and nuclear filtering as perturbatively calculable phenomena.
